Its not uncommon for games deveolpers to rerelease old games and give them a graphical make over, it happened with Tomb Raider when they release Annversery and it happened with Pokemon when they release Firered/Leafgreen.

So my qeastion is if Sega decided to remake Sonic Adventures with updated graphics and improved game play, what would you what changed?, would you even buy it if they rereleased it?

For me Sonic Adventures was one of they better games in the 3D sonic era, it would have amazing potential and would probatly sell loads with just a grapics upgrade.
